Tenuta Sant'Antonio was established in 1989 when the four Castagnedi brothers, moved by a passion for wine growing and driven by an entrepreneurial streak, decided to acquire 30 hectares of vineyards in the Mezzane area. The climate in these areas is mitigated by breezes from Lake Garda with compact calcareous soils, which lend minerality and freshness to the wines. All these components are enhanced through natural work in the vineyard and wine cellar, so that each cultivated truth can express itself and the terroir from which it comes. Tenute Sant'Antonio's “Scaia” line is dedicated to a line of wines based on the utmost respect for the environment and special attention paid to all vinification steps. The soils of the “Scaia” varieties consist mainly of chalk, limestone and stone, which are called “scaie” in the local dialect. Trevenezie Scaia IGT is made from a blend of 55% Garganega and 45% Chardonnay, which after soft pressing undergoes alcoholic fermentation in stainless steel containers at a low temperature. A young wine in the glass with a delicate straw yellow colour. On the nose it expresses floral notes alongside fruity hints of white peach and more enveloping tones tending towards exotic fruit, such as banana, typical of Chardonnay. On the palate, it is pleasantly fresh and closes on savoury notes. Perfect for every day, it goes well with fish or shellfish based dishes, or delicate white meats.
